DAYTON —
A vehicle, which Sheriff’s deputies had attempted to pull over earlier in the morning for loud music, smashed through a structure on Prescott Avenue around 4:30 a.m., according to police.
Police are looking for the suspect or suspects, which are believed to have jumped out of the vehicle and fled the scene on foot, police said.
Officers responded to the 3900 block of Prescott and once crews arrived they discovered one vehicle had crashed into another vehicle and damaged a car port.
The vehicle was driving westbound on Prescott when it crossed into a yard, crashed through a fence, and hit the other vehicle parked under a car port, police said. The two vehicles then collided with a support pole of the car port, which knocked the car port down.
The case remains under investigation.
